About Mama's Daughters' Diner

Mama’s Daughters’ Diner is an easygoing destination in Forney, Texas, serving beloved American diner and comfort-food classics in a casual, cozy, quiet, and historic setting. Located at 111 E Main St, the diner offers a welcoming place to enjoy everything from eggs and other breakfast favorites to burgers, pies, and satisfying comfort-food meals.

Whether you are stopping in for a quick bite, meeting someone for coffee, or settling in for a full meal, the menu includes coffee, small plates, vegetarian options, and familiar dishes suited to a range of preferences.

Breakfast, brunch, lunch, and dinner are all available, with options for solo dining as well as counter service and comfortable seating. Guests can also enjoy great coffee, a strong tea selection, great desserts, and local specialties. For added convenience, Mama’s Daughters’ Diner provides dine-in, takeaway, delivery, no-contact delivery, on-site services, and catering.

Reservations are accepted, making it easier to plan a visit for a relaxed meal or a larger dining occasion.

Accessibility and convenience are important parts of the experience, with a wheelchair-accessible car park, entrance, seating, and toilet. Restroom facilities are available, and customers can pay with credit cards, debit cards, or NFC mobile payments.

Been a while since I stopped in so thought I would check in. Ordered the Chicken Fried Steak with 3 vegetables ( I chose Mashed Potatoes, Fried Okra, and Baked Squash) special, ice tea, and came with choice of roll or cornbread. (I had both) Thought I would try brown gravy for a change as I like it on my Potatos normally or on a smothered Steak. CFS was cooked perfectly and seemed to be homade but was not as hot as I hoped but was at a perfect temp to scarf it down lol. Brown gravy was way too salty and also needed some black pepper. Mash potatoes were perfect and just lumpy enough to give a real potato taste. Okra was not as hot as am used too but it was at a temp to enjoy the entire bowl pretty quick. Baked squash was the only miss. It was kinda bready and sweet. I was hoping for bigger pieces of squash and more squash flavor. Roll was perfect! Buttery, Soft, warm, fluffy and delicious. Cornbread was just right sweetness but need more cornmeal and less flour as it was too bready for me. Overall great experience and server was great, fast and friendly. Will be back soon.
